**Handover: Crumbline order-cutoff rule**

Before you review the pull request, some context. The Crumbline bakery platform enforces a per-store order cutoff so kitchens get their prep list by closing time. The rule used to be hardcoded to a single hour; my change makes it configurable per region, with a fallback default if a store has none set. Timezone handling is the fiddly part — all cutoffs are stored in store-local time. The current values are these.

config for tagep-yajef:
ulawyn:
  log_level: error
  metrics_host: metrics.ulawyn.lumiclabs.internal
  pin: 0564
  pool_size: 32

Action item from the Brindle outage review: our SQL files had no lint gate, which let an unqualified DELETE reach staging. We now run Querylint in CI on every file under /migrations and /reports; builds fail on missing WHERE clauses, implicit casts, and reserved-word identifiers. New team members should install the pre-commit hook on day one. Rule definitions and suppression guidance are maintained on the page below.

dashboard of yafog-fajof = https://jira.tolvaqsys.internal/pages/pages/projects/49fe21c4

Quarterly Planning Note — Customer Concentration

For the finance team: our largest account, Drovemont Retail Partners, now represents 38% of recurring revenue, up from 29% last year. This exceeds our internal threshold and warrants action this quarter. Planned steps include accelerating mid-market pipeline work and tightening contract renewal terms. Model downside scenarios assuming partial loss of the account by year-end. The mitigation strategy agreed at the planning session is recorded in the note below.

board note of kagup-tawif: Sorionax Logistics is in early talks to buy Praaelax Group for about $53.1 million. The Kelmir launch date is March 20, and nothing goes to the press before then.

## Artifact Signing

Heads up: every validator plugin for Checkwright must be signed before the loader will touch it. Unsigned plugins get quarantined, not rejected silently — check the loader log if something vanishes. Rotate the key yearly and update the trust manifest in the same commit. The current public signing key is below.

deploy key for kajof-fajop: bky6_gDHw9Q